credits

released November 5, 2021

Shoestrings are Mario & Rose Suau. All songs written, recorded and produced by Shoestrings.
Mixed by Mario Suau. Mastered by Andrew Rose.
Artwork by Sean Mahan seanmahanart.com
Cover design by Matthew Jacobson. Additional design by Erickson Raif.
